You hitting behind the ball? Digging holes?
No not usually. When i'm trying to hold a little lag and hit down what i'm actually doing is swinging out. To better understand that, what I mean is that if at address your hands are hanging... at impact they'd be reaching. You dig? I even know it and still keep doing it. My shots are sooooo much better when I play the ball a little back in my stance and hit down. I need to get back to achieving that without the "reaching" that for some reason my mind is substituting for holding lag.
